Pompeo says Iran responsible for Saudi attacks

20 September


US Secretary of State Mike Pompeo says Iran is responsible for the September 14 attacks on Saudi oil facilities.


He made the comments during a visit to the Middle East to investigate the attacks. Tehran has denied responsibility.


Pompeo spoke to reporters in the United Arab Emirates after visiting Saudi Arabia.


Pompeo said the US wants a peaceful resolution to the issue, but that Washington is set to impose more sanctions on Iran.


Tehran has repeatedly rejected the US allegations. Iran-backed anti-government Houthi rebels in Yemen have claimed responsibility for the attacks.


Iranian Foreign Minister Mohammad Javad Zarif told CNN Thursday that if the US or Saudi military strike the country, the consequence would be an "all-out war."


The United Nations plans to send a team to investigate the attacks in Saudi Arabia. The Saudi government has said it will cooperate with the UN probe.
